ECGC Probationary Officer Recruitment 2025 – Complete Job Overview
The Export Credit Guarantee Corporation of India (ECGC) has announced the recruitment of Probationary Officers for the year 2025. This is a significant opportunity for graduates aspiring to join a leading government-backed sector in the financial and insurance domain. The recruitment drive includes 30 vacancies across different streams, offering an attractive salary package and promising career growth.

Vacancy Distribution and Eligibility Criteria
Vacancy Details
The 30 vacancies are categorized as follows:
| Category | Number of Vacancies |
|---|---|
| Generalist | 28 |
| Specialist (Rajbhasha) | 2 |
Educational Qualifications
Candidates must possess the following qualifications to be eligible:
Bachelor’s Degree
Any discipline from a university recognized by the Government of India or an equivalent qualification. You must have a valid mark sheet or degree certificate indicating graduation on the day of registration. During online registration, you must also specify the percentage of marks obtained in graduation.
Master’s Degree in Relevant Language Fields
For candidates applying under the language specialization streams, the preferred qualifications include:
- Master’s degree in Hindi / Hindi Translation with English as a core/ elective/ major subject at the bachelor’s level, with a minimum of 55% for SC/ST and 60% for others.
- Master’s degree in English with Hindi as core/ elective/ major at the bachelor’s level, with minimum 55% for SC/ST and 60% for others.
- Master’s degree in any discipline with English and Hindi as core/ elective/ major subjects at undergraduate level, with the same percentage criteria.
- Master’s degree in both English and Hindi/Hindi translation, with minimum 55% for SC/ST and 60% for others.
Age Limit and Relaxation Policy
The age criteria are as follows, as of November 1, 2025:
| Age Limit | Details |
|---|---|
| Minimum Age | 21 years |
| Maximum Age | 30 years |
Age relaxation is applicable as per government rules for reserved categories.

Selection Process
The selection of candidates will be based on a combination of performance in an online examination and personal interview. The overall merit will be assessed considering the candidates’ scores in both stages.
Selection Stages
Online Examination
This will assess your knowledge in subjects relevant to the role, including reasoning, quantitative aptitude, English language, and professional knowledge.
Interview
Candidates qualifying the online exam will be called for an interview, which will evaluate their suitability for the role, communication skills, and overall personality.
Merit List and Final Selection
Successful candidates will be shortlisted based on merit and will receive a joining letter, subject to fulfilling all eligibility criteria and verification processes. The merit list remains valid for one year, and vacancies arising within this period may be filled accordingly.
Important Considerations
- The final decision rests with ECGC, and all recruitment processes are conducted as per government policies.
- Candidates must ensure that all details provided in the application are accurate; no modifications are possible after submission.
- Reserved candidates selected under unreserved criteria will not be adjusted against reserved quotas, but their category status remains unchanged.
- In case of identical scores, precedence will be given based on age, with older candidates ranked higher.
